As for our plug-in, that's something we've thought about a lot. We're keen
to encourage people to use it for two reasons. First, I'm personally a big
believer in what DM can do for websites and want other people to see it the
way I see it! Second, we would obviously like to develop business in that
area if possible.

For the time being our approach is basically that if people want to use the
plug-in for their sites they can, and we will supply the necessary bits of
HTML, Javascript etc to help them do so free of charge, on condition that
the control is visible with our logo and link to our site. A couple of
people are in the process of developing content on this basis at the moment.

Our aim is to help people to create a range of sites which will help us to
show better what the technology can do and take it from there. It should
also help us accumulate more information about any remaining bugs so we can
get them fixed asap.
